Hello

I made a quick patch for wine 1.1.43 based on the patch for 1.1.32,
and while this worked so far up to 1.1.40, it now refuses to compile:

# build winelib programs
/usr/bin/make -C build32/programs LIBSUFFIX="-unstable" DATASUFFIX="-unstable" dlldir="/usr/lib/wine-unstable"
make[1]: Entering directory `/usr/src/wine-1.1.43/build32/programs'
make[1]: *** No targets specified and no makefile found.  Stop.
make[1]: Leaving directory `/usr/src/wine-1.1.43/build32/programs'
make: *** [build-arch32-stamp] Error 2
dpkg-buildpackage: error: debian/rules build gave error exit status 2

The patches are quite ugly, mostly the result of search-and-replace,
plus processing rejects and making a new diff when something did not 
apply. Most noteably, the changelogs are all amess. 

I attached two of them anyway, maybe this helps.
